Biological Background: eIF4A Function and Localization
- eIF4A-1 (P60842), also known as DDX2A, is an ATP-dependent RNA helicase and a core subunit of the eIF4F translation initiation complex.
- As part of eIF4F, eIF4A-1 participates in cap-dependent translation initiation by unwinding RNA secondary structures in the 5'-UTR of mRNAs, enabling ribosome binding and scanning for the start codon.
Related references: PMID:20156963 - This helicase activity is essential for efficient protein synthesis and contributes to cell proliferation and growth.
- The eIF4A family consists of three highly homologous members: eIF4A-1 (P60842), eIF4A-2 (Q14240), and eIF4A-3 (P38919), all sharing conserved DEAD-box helicase domains.
- Subcellular localization includes the cytoplasm, perinuclear region, cell membrane, and stress granules, where it is recruited under cellular stress.
- Post-translational modifications such as acetylation, phosphorylation, and ubiquitination regulate its activity and stability.
- eIF4A-1 is also implicated in host-virus interactions, playing roles in the replication of certain viruses.
Experimental Guidance and Technical Tips
- The immunogen is a synthetic peptide covering the N-terminal region (aa 1-100) of human eIF4A-1. The resulting polyclonal antibody may recognize multiple eIF4A family members due to high sequence conservation; consider verifying specificity for your target isoform in the relevant cell or tissue lysate.
- For Western blotting, a dominant band around 46 kDa is expected for eIF4A-1, with possible additional bands corresponding to eIF4A-2 (approx. 46 kDa) and eIF4A-3 (approx. 48 kDa). Use appropriate positive and negative controls.
- In immunofluorescence/ICC, staining may be observed in the cytoplasm and nucleus, with possible enrichment at the perinuclear region or in stress granules under stress conditions. Pre-treatment of cells to induce stress granule formation (e.g., with arsenite) can be used for localization studies.
- For ELISA, the antibody is suitable as a capture or detection reagent in sandwich formats; cross-reactivity with other eIF4A family proteins should be assessed empirically.
- As a polyclonal antibody, consistent performance across lots should be validated; consider employing internal reference standards for quantitative assays.
